Avacta delivers two clinical stage peptide-drug conjugates to target delivery of toxic payloads into the tumour microenvironment

Avacta, a UK-based clinical stage biotech, is differentiated clinical-stage oncology specialist, increasingly defined by continuing progress with its second-generation pre|CISION tumour-activated Peptide Drug Conjugate (PDC) platform.

The lead Gen Two programme, AVA6103 (FAP-EXd, an FAP-activated, controlled-release exatecan), has delivered initial Phase Ia safety and pharmacokinetic data from the FOCUS-01 trial.

These data provide early human validation that the platform successfully replicates the targeted tissue localisation seen in preclinical models. They show a three-fold reduction in systemic payload exposure compared to market-leading antibody-drug conjugate (ADC) benchmarks and avoid the severe myelosuppression typically associated with free topoisomerase I inhibitors. Further clinical news flow over the next 12 months should establish the utility, positioning, and value of the pre|CISION platform.

Initial FOCUS-01 data confirm pre|CISION kinetics Preliminary phase Ia safety and pharmacokinetic data for the lead Gen Two programme, AVA6103, provide the first human validation of the optimised FAP-activated platform. Initial escalation cohorts demonstrate a three-fold reduction in systemic payload exposure compared to existing antibody-drug conjugate benchmarks. While these findings remain exploratory, they indicate that the engineered capping group successfully anchors the parent conjugate within the tumour microenvironment (TME) to create a localised, slow-release reservoir.

FOCUS-01 phase Ib expansion to provide first efficacy data phase Ia dose escalation is continuing through the remaining cohorts, with full safety findings expected by late-2026. The phase Ib portion of the study, planned for early-2027 across six high-prevalence solid tumour indications, is structured to evaluate objective response rates and disease control in these indication-specific cohorts, with initial efficacy data expected to emerge in H127. This transition would represent a critical milestone should pre|CISION translate its pharmacokinetic safety margins into measurable clinical utility.

Proof of mechanism data prompts us to revisit assumptions for our pre|CISION platform valuation given potential for pipeline expansion with multiple payloads addressing the wider 90% of FAP-expressing solid tumours. Cash of £16.4 million at end-April 2026 provides a runway into Q127, covering several value inflection points. Future funding options include licensing/partnering deals, an additional NASDAQ listing, and further equity raises. Our rNPV model values Avacta at £525 million or 111p/share (105p fully diluted) vs £475 million or 101p per share (94p fully diluted) previously.
